WebFeb 11, 2024 · The point-slope formula states: (y − y1) = m(x −x1) Where m is the slope and (x1 y1) is a point the line passes through. Substituting the information from the problem gives: (y −4) = −5(x − 3) Or we can convert to the slope-intercept form by solving for y. The slope-intercept form of a linear equation is: y = mx +b
